Costochondritis?: As you have ruled out the major and most concerning causes, check yourself for costochondritis. This is a condition that produces pain where your ribs attach to your breast bone (sternum). Trace the ribs in the area until you feel a small bump and soft spot right where the rib attaches. Pain is associated w/exercise ; heavy lifting.
